MKONO Farm is a small batch swinery that specializes in the slow growing heritage breed Kunekune from New Zealand. We are a pastured piggery that practices pasture rotation fostering permaculture systems on farm. We strive to utilize the Kunekune pig in every facet we can by selling show/breeding stock, homestead stock, feeders to whole pig, roasters, meat by the cut, and charcuterie.  Our pigs are humanely raised, well loved, and grass fed from start to finish.

Family owned and operated by Jason and Amanda Hand, MKONO Farm had its beginnings with the unique responsibility of producing small batch exclusive heritage products for Washington D.C, Northern Virginia, and Maryland in late 2017. Our farm was birthed on the fertile banks of the Patuxent River in Southern Maryland, where we used our natural environment to raise, grow and harvest food that is as nature intended healthy and delicious.  Our flavorful products are sustainably produced FREE FROM hormones, antibiotics, GMO's and other junk.

In August of 2021, we moved the farm from Southern Indiana. Going back to our home states roots after 20+ years is something we are thankful we have the opportunity to do. It is time to reconnect with our family and perfect our small batch swinery and charcuterie goodness here in Indiana on a bigger farm. 

We are a Homegrown by Heroes Indiana Grown farm member and members of the Farm Veterans Coalition. MKONO farm is also a certified pork production farm with Kunekune Pork Producers Association and adheres to the KPPA's stingent set of animal welfare and program guidlines.
